Keep in mind that when visitors come to your site, they are looking for something specific, so make sure that what they are looking for is easy to find. You can be the highest ranked site for specific keywords, which means you did a good job of search engine optimization, but even the highest rankings and a huge amount of traffic does not ensure that the people that visit your website will buy from your site. Once a customer has visited your site, you must be able to ensure that he is interested enough with your site contents, information, products or services to stay for awhile and even return often. The information on your site must be clear, easy to navigate through and must motivate the visitor to buy your products or services. If you sell more than one product or service, the various products can be on different pages, but make sure that there are clear links to help guide the visitor to ALL products they might want to purchase. By providing clear and easily navigable links, the visitor can easily link to each of the pages for the information they are looking for.

Understanding Your Target Customer

Without understanding who your customers really are and what they are looking for, it will not matter how well your website is designed, or high your search engine rankings are. An online presence in the form of a website can be either an extension, or even a replacement for, a typical “brick and mortar” store. One of the great qualities of a website is that you can get input from your visitors through the use of online surveys or questionnaires, or just ask them to provide their name and email address so that you can send them surveys, newsletters and product updates, etc. You can ask them about the selections they have made from your products. What is it about your products that they like (or don’t like). Would they like to have discount coupons for your products? Is the quality and cost of your products competitive? Are your shipping costs less than competitors? How about customer support? Are your responses to questions timely? Are the descriptions of your products clear and completely define what they are buying? What about guarantees and return policy? Are they competitive? The great thing about an online business is that you can ask your customers to fill out simple contact forms that will provide you with their, name, address, email, age, gender, and shopping preferences and interests.

The advantage of an online business is that it is open 24×7 and your customers can be anywhere in the world and still shop whenever they want. You should provide a link on every page to a contact page that gives your customers your complete mailing address, telephone number and email address, or better yet, provide an online contact form that they can email to you directly from your site. There are numerous reasons that customers may need to contact you such as general sales or specific product information or technical issues. If you do not check your online store email often, have your email automatically forwarded to an email that you do check often, or even to one that gets delivered to your cell phone or PDA. Finally, make sure that you make the actual checkout and purchase process as simple and fast as possible by providing several payment options such as credit or debit cards, PayPal, etc.
